I am setting up a business where i need a mobile phone. I dont want a contract as i only really require it for incoming calls. I will be dialing out with another phone should i need to. This is mainly for people who need to contact me. cheaper the better...

1. Buy a cheap reconditioned phone.
2. Get a free o2 or virgin sim from one of there promotions, which has a little credit to start off with, but can still recieve incoming calls.
